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3826302 125673 9146884294 878 8232
7494 00056826
7494 00056826
7437205 6010 315359 21762110036 09
All about undefined
Interested in learning more?
7494 00056826
7437205 6010 315359 21762110036 09
See more
76357700224 95767854
45 30 85 044435243
See more
8388 6082804 92148684165
896 4324 0035480 2906474803
See more